1997 Lexus ES 300 V6-3.0L (1MZ-FE)
Manual Transmission/Transaxle
1997 Lexus ES 300 V6-3.0L (1MZ-FE)SECTION Manual Transmission/Transaxle
TYPE 75W-90, 80W-90, GL-4, GL-5(Gear Oil, API Service GL-4, GL-5)
CAPACITY, Refill:
ES250, ES300 4.2 liters 8.8 pints
SC300 2.6 liters 5.5 pints
